Where to Watch the Dodgers Tonight on TV
Local Broadcast and Regional Sports Networks
For most fans in the Los Angeles area, the Dodgers air on Spectrum SportsNet, which is the primary regional home. If you rely on an antenna, check whether your local over-the-air station holds temporary syndication, though this is less common for routine games.
On satellite, DirecTV carries Spectrum SportsNet on channel 619, making it a reliable path for suburban and rural subscribers with a clear southern sky view. Confirm your DirecTV package includes the regional sports tier to avoid surprises.
Streaming Services Carrying the Game
Subscription-Based Platforms
Streaming services handle the Dodgers differently based on local rights, so it pays to check the schedule inside each app. YouTube TV includes Spectrum SportsNet in higher-tier plans, while FuboTV organizes regional sports into add-on packs. Sling TV and Hulu + Live TV may carry the game depending on which sports add-ons you select, so verify before game time.
Keep in mind that blackouts can restrict streaming access to the team’s designated market, meaning you might only see national broadcasts on networks like Apple TV+ or ESPN. Using a VPN does not reliably bypass these rules and could violate terms of service.

Does the Dodgers game always air on the same channel tonight?
Not always, because regional rights are stable but national telecasts move across networks. Always check the channel guide for your specific location, since the same game might appear on Spectrum SportsNet, a national network, or a streaming add-on depending on the date.
Can I watch the Dodgers game for free if I do not subscribe to cable?
You may catch a portion of the game on an over-the-air station if local syndication applies, or use a free trial from a streaming service that includes Spectrum SportsNet. After the trial, subscription fees usually apply to keep watching.
